Thea Austin fits many categories, platinum selling recording artist and writer, sultry diva, powerful vocalist,
producer, lyricist, stunning beauty, international performer. She is an icon in the global music community and has
worked with the brightest the industry has to offer and achieved the highest possible chart success multiple times.

Born in Pittsburgh, PA, Austin has been fronting bands since she was in her early teens…but has been a working
singer since she was eight! At the young age of four she began singer with her sister and by eight, they were getting
gigs.

In the late 1980s singing led Austin to Los Angeles, CA where she immediately began working in studio with R&B
heavyweights like Sami McKinney, Alan Rich and Michael O’Hara and her work soon led to live performances and
recording opportunities.

Her travels led her to Penny Ford , the former lead singer of SNAP!, who was working on a solo project. Thea was
whisked to Germany to begin work on SNAP’s album The Madman’s Return together with the rapper Turbo B. She
not only sang, but co-authored many of the cuts including the multi-generational anthem “Rhythm Is A Dancer.”
That song has lived on through 25 years and continues to be a hit as Austin tours with the “I Love the 90s” show
singing it worldwide.
